Shadreck Mlauzi joins Bosso

Fungai Muderere, [email protected]

FORMER Mighty Warriors head coach Shadreck Mlauzi is serving his internship at Highlanders’ developmental side Bosso 90.

Mlauzi is currently pursuing a Confederation of African Football (Caf) badge in Tanzania.

“I will be working with Bosso90 on an attachment that is set to end sometime in September. It has been quite a good eye opener for me. I was welcomed well at Highlanders, and I’m very much grateful to Bosso 90 head coach Melusi Mabaleka Sibanda,” said Mlauzi.

With two rounds of play already in the Zifa Southern Division One League, Bosso 90 are on position 11 with a single point.

In their previous fixture, Mlauzi and Sibanda’s charges drew one all against army side Indlovu Iyanyathela.

“I believe we have so far had a good run. Yes, it’s early days yet and there is still room for improvement from our side. The boys will certainly get better as the season progresses. The boys are willing to learn which is very encouraging,” added Mlauzi.

Sibanda said in Mlauzi, he has found a great helper.

“Mlauzi has been instrumental. He is a gifted coach and I’m actually learning a lot from him. We have given him a free role and as an institution, I think we are going to benefit more from him,” said Sibanda.

In recent years, Mlauzi penned a physical education and sports book, titled Anima Sana In Corpore Sano which went on to find its way into classes after being approved for use by Ordinary Level pupils.

According to a report by the Curriculum Development and Technical Services department, the manuscript met the relevant criteria including the content covering the whole syllabus and became appropriate for Ordinary Level students.

The book includes chapters on nutrition, diet and physical activity, substances and anti-doping, fundamentals of fitness, human body systems and muscular system.

The former Inline Academy coach was in charge of the Mighty Warriors when the women’s senior football team made history by qualifying for Olympics and were part of the biggest sporting showcase at Rio 2016 in           Brazil.

Earlier this year, Mlauzi was cleared by the Confederation of Southern African Football Association (Cosafa) Ethics Committee of sexual assault charges that were levelled against him.

Mlauzi was facing allegations of indecently assaulting a female member of the senior women’s technical team in South Africa during the Cosafa Women’s Championship 2023.

Mlauzi’s exoneration by the Cosafa Ethics Committee came after he was cleared of the same charges by the courts.

A decision was made by the three-member Cosafa Ethics Committee and it has since been communicated to the Zimbabwe Football Association (Zifa) and copied to Mlauzi and his accuser.

In a judgment seen by Zimpapers Sports Hub, the Cosafa Ethics Committee chairperson Mamy Natach Andrianaivosa wrote:

“Having considered all evidence submitted, both orally and in documentary form, and determining the matter on a balance of probabilities, the committee finds the evidence of the accused more probable and consequently does not believe the complainant’s version.

“The effect of the finding in (1) above means the committee could not find that a case for sexual harassment against the accused exists.”

The committee recommended that there was a need for the association to have a workshop on sexual harassment in the region and prepare a public meeting room for use by all associations.

“Cosafa safeguarding service ought to prepare a public meeting room for use by all associations to avoid meeting in single rooms and establish a schedule for use in each tournament or Cosafa event,” further read the judgment.

In a letter written to the Zimbabwe Football Association (Zifa) dated January 17 and copied to Mlauzi and his accuser, Cosafa executive director Sue Destombes emphasised the need to review the findings by their ethics committee. – @FungaiMuderere
